承接上期《Altium Designer 2024 原理图高级功能:层次式原理图实战精讲+全网最全避坑指南》,我们彻底搞定了层次式原理图的分层架构、跨页连接、模块化拆分,解决了复杂电路图纸杂乱、逻辑混乱、迭代困难的核心问题。
但在实际硬件设计中,很多工程师会遇到新的痛点:多路采样、多路运放、多路电源、多路串口、阵列式LED电路等重复模块化通道电路。
明明8路、16路电路原理图完全一致,却只能手动复制粘贴、逐路修改位号、反复同步PCB布局,不仅耗时翻倍,还极易出现位号错乱、网络冲突、布线不一致、改版漏改等低级问题,返工率极高。
今天这篇就针对该行业痛点,精讲AD2024多通道电路批量设计+高效复用核心技巧,从原理逻辑、手把手实战步骤、参数化配置、PCB联动复用,到99%工程师都会踩的隐藏坑点逐一拆解,帮大家实现一次绘图、无限复用、批量同步、零差错迭代,大幅提升复杂多通道电路设计效率。
一、为什么一定要学 AD2024 多通道设计?
首先明确:多通道设计(Multi-Channel Design)≠ 普通复制粘贴,它是基于层次化原理图的高阶复用机制,也是AD官方主推的标准化多阵列电路设计方案。
定义:多通道设计是指在层次原理图中有一个或多个的通道(原理图)会被重复调用,可根据需要多次使用层次原理图中的任意一个子图,从而避免重复绘制多次相同的原理。
普通复制粘贴的致命缺陷:
(1)多通道电路每一路独立,无法批量同步修改,改一路需改全部;
(2)手动复制易出现位号重复、网络名错乱、参数不一致问题;
(3)PCB布局无法智能复用,每一路都要重新布线、摆位,一致性差;
(4)工程臃肿,图纸冗余,后期查错、改版、维护难度极大。
AD2024多通道批量设计的核心优势:
(1)一次绘制,多路实例化:仅需绘制单路模块原理图,通过指令批量生成N路通道,无需重复绘图;
(2)全局联动修改:修改底层子图,所有通道同步更新,彻底杜绝漏改、错改;
(3)参数化独立配置:支持全局统一参数+单通道独立参数,适配轻微差异化多通道电路;
(4)PCB一键复用布局:搭配ROOM区域复用,多路电路布局布线一键同步,规整统一、节省大量时间;
(5)工程极简整洁:无冗余图纸,层级清晰,编译无报错,适配量产、迭代、交接场景。
适用场景:多路模拟采样、多路运放调理、多路继电器控制、多路串口/RS485、阵列指示灯、多声道音频电路、多通道电源模块等所有重复阵列式电路。
二、AD2024多通道设计核心原理
多通道设计是层次式原理图的进阶延伸,核心依托「顶层图纸+子模块图纸+Repeat批量实例化指令」实现。
1. 核心架构逻辑
顶层原理图:放置多通道子图符号,通过Repeat语法定义通道数量、通道序号范围;
底层子原理图:绘制单路完整功能电路,包含器件、网络、端口,无需手动编号多通道;
软件编译逻辑:AD2024编译工程时,会根据Repeat参数自动批量实例化多路通道,自动分配唯一位号、网络后缀,实现物理多路、逻辑同源的设计效果。
2. 核心语法标准
子图符号标识填写规则:Repeat(模块名, 起始通道, 结束通道)
示例:Repeat(AMP,1,8) —— 代表批量生成1-8路AMP运放通道,共8路多通道电路;
这是多通道设计的核心指令,也是区别于普通层次图的关键,AD2024对该语法的兼容性、编译稳定性做了大幅优化,杜绝了旧版本通道序号错乱问题。
三、AD2024多通道批量设计实战全流程
以一个工程文件为例,将其中LED电路模块重复调用为例。
(1)新建一个名称为LED的工程,将LED电路模块绘制于LED.SchDoc文件中。
(2)新建一个Main.SchDoc文件,在此文件下执行菜单栏中“Design”—“Create Sheet Symbol From Sheet”命令;或在原理图空白处右击,从弹出的快捷菜单栏执行“Sheet Actions”—“Create Sheet Symbol From Sheet”命令。
(3)从弹出的Choose Document to Place对话框中选择需要调用的原理图。选中之后单击OK按钮,可得到下图的页面符。
(4)在Main.SchDoc文件中建立多通道设置,进行其他器件的连接。
以建立4个通道为例,多通道设置有以下两种方式:
① 在层次原理图中建立一个通道就调用一次子原理图,如下图
② 使用Repeat语句创建多通道原理图
使用Repeat关键字时,Designator字段的语法如下:
Repeat(<ChannelIdentifier>,<ChannelIndex_1>,<LastChannelIndex_n>)
其中:
ChannelIdentifier——子原理图的文件名称;
ChannelIndex_1——通道开始值,此处必须从1开始;
LastChannelIndex_n——通道的终止值,表示有几个通道;
若有重复使用的信号,则其图纸入口的Name改为Repeat(信号名)。
a.双击LED页面符的Designator和重复信号的图纸入口,改为Repeat语句
b.上述完成后,将其它元件用导线进行连接,如下图,需要使用总线
(5)对器件位号进行标注
执行菜单栏中“Tools”——“Annotation”——“Annotate Schematics”
在Annotate中,选择Update——Accept
(6)设置各通道Room空间和标识符格式,便于从原理图的单个逻辑器件导入PCB的多个物理元件,即让PCB元件有唯一独立的位号。
执行菜单栏中“Project”——“Project Options”命令,在打开的对话框中选择“Multi-Channel”标签,在“Room Naming Style”或“Designator Format”下拉框选择合适的命名方式。
(7)对工程进行编译,以确保建立的层次原理图形成层次关系,所修改的Room名称和位号格式改变有效。
执行菜单栏的“Project”——“Validate PCB Project LED.PrjPcb”命令
(8)编译之后,若出现“多个网络名称”错误,可有以下两种方式解决:
① 在Project Options,选择Error Reporting标签,将Net with multiple names设置为“No Report”;
② 在受影响的网络上放置一个No ERC标记
(9)建立一个PCB文件,为原理图器件添加封装后,执行菜单栏中“Design”——“Update PCB Document PCB1.PcbDoc”命令
(10)导入PCB后,就可以看到有4路通道,每个通道都有一个Room区域,这个区域不能删除。
(11)布局好一个Room后,可执行Design——Rooms——Copy Room Formats命令,可以快速完成其它通道的布局。
四、AD2024多通道设计全网最全避坑指南
结合量产项目经验,整理多通道设计高频报错、隐形bug、兼容问题,每一个都是实战踩坑总结,直接规避返工。
·坑1:Repeat语法书写错误,编译无通道/通道缺失
问题现象:编译后只显示单路通道,无法批量生成多路实例,无报错但功能失效。
原因:语法括号、空格、大小写不规范,模块名与子图文件名不匹配,起始/结束序号颠倒。
解决方案:严格遵循 Repeat(模块名,起始,结束) 格式,无多余空格,模块名统一大小写,结束序号>起始序号。
·坑2:子图端口带数字,导致多通道网络冲突
问题现象:编译报网络重复错误,多通道信号串扰,PCB网络混乱。
原因:子图端口命名带1/2/3等数字后缀,批量实例化后无法自动区分通道网络。
解决方案:子图端口统一纯英文命名(IN、OUT、EN),不加数字、序号,由AD自动分配通道后缀。
·坑3:手动修改单通道器件,导致工程同步错乱
问题现象:修改某一路通道器件参数,重新编译后恢复原状,或部分通道参数不一致。
原因:多通道核心是“同源复用”,所有通道依赖底层子图,单路手动修改无法全局同步。
解决方案:统一在底层子图修改通用参数,差异化参数通过页面参数配置实现,禁止单路手动改器件。
·坑4:PCB模块复用出现区域重叠、器件错位
问题现象:ROOM复用布局后,部分通道器件重叠、布线交叉,位置偏移。
原因:前期未预留足够布局空间,通道偏移位号(Channel Offset)匹配错误。
解决方案:提前规划多通道布局区域,统一通道偏移参数,错位器件手动匹配正确Offset位号后重新复用。
·坑5:多通道电源/地未做隔离,出现隐性串扰
问题现象:原理图编译无报错,上电后多路通道信号互相干扰,采样数据跳动。
原因:多通道共用单点地、电源,未做通道独立网络隔离,批量复用后隐性串扰。
解决方案:关键模拟多通道电路,采用通道独立地网络(GND1、GND2),单点汇接,避免共地干扰。
·坑6:新旧版本工程兼容报错
问题现象:旧版本AD工程导入AD2024后,多通道实例失效、位号错乱。
解决方案:打开工程后执行“工程”-“重置编译缓存”,重新编译,更新多通道参数配置,适配2024版内核规则。
五、高阶复用技巧:让多通道设计效率最大化
1. 多通道+总线批量布线
多路信号无需单路接线,顶层采用总线对接多通道子图端口,原理图简洁清爽,彻底告别飞线杂乱问题,适配16路、32路超多通道设计。
2. 模板化子图,一键复用至所有项目
将常用多通道模块(运放调理、多路开关、多路采样)保存为工程模板,后续新项目直接调用,无需重复绘图,实现模块化快速复用。
3. 批量位号重置与规整
多通道编译完成后,使用AD2024“批量注释”功能,统一规整所有通道位号,杜绝跳号、乱号,适配量产BOM导出需求。
六、全文总结
多通道批量设计是AD2024原理图高阶能力的核心,也是硬件工程师从“手动画图”进阶“高效标准化设计”的关键技能。相比于低效的复制粘贴,基于层次架构的多通道复用,能彻底解决多阵列电路绘图慢、改版繁、差错高、PCB不规整四大痛点。
核心记住:单图打底、Repeat批量实例、参数化差异化、PCB模块复用、规避端口与语法坑点,即可轻松搞定所有多通道重复电路设计。
下期预告
下期更新《Altium Designer 2024原理图高级功能-信号线束实战精讲+避坑指南》
带你搞定高密度复杂电路的信号线束打包、分组管理、总线与线束区别、线束跨页连接、整洁化绘图规范,彻底解决多信号、多总线图纸杂乱问题,让你的原理图达到量产级规整标准!
关注连载,持续解锁AD2024高阶实战技巧,告别低效设计!